Attorney Hadi Harp’s Volunteer Work at Dearborn Expungement Fair

On October 21, 2022, Attorney Hadi Harp participated in the City of Dearborn’s Expungement Fair, where more than 100 individuals came seeking help to clear eligible criminal records. The event was part of a broader effort to give people a real opportunity to move forward—by removing convictions that had long limited access to jobs, housing, education, and other parts of everyday life.

Why Expungement Matters

Expungement is more than paperwork—it can be a turning point. A cleared record can mean the chance to apply for jobs without fear, access stable housing, or go back to school. But the process can be confusing without help, and many people are turned away simply because they’re unsure of the rules or how to apply.

By volunteering at the Dearborn Expungement Fair, Hadi helped remove that barrier for dozens of individuals. The event was hosted in partnership with the City of Dearborn, the Michigan Attorney General’s office, and local community groups.
